2012/7/25 Chris Jerdonek <chris.jerdo...@gmail.com>: > I have a few questions about feature freeze: > > (1) Is increasing test coverage acceptable during feature freeze, even > if it does not involve fixing a bug? > > (2) When adding new tests (e.g. in the course of fixing a bug or > increasing test coverage), are we allowed to refactor other tests so > that supporting test code can be shared? Or should the tests be added > in a less DRY fashion and refactored only after the branch goes back > to pre-alpha?
You can do basically anything you want to tests just as long as you don't make them less stable. > > (3) What types of documentation changes are allowed during feature > freeze? For example, are we only allowed to fix incorrect > information, or is it acceptable to improve or add to the information > about existing functionality? All documentation changes are accepted. -- Regards, Benjamin _______________________________________________ Python-Dev mailing list Python-Dev@python.org http://mail.python.org/mailman/listinfo/python-dev Unsubscribe: http://mail.python.org/mailman/options/python-dev/archive%40mail-archive.com
